2014-08-19 |
Juergen Ributzka | Reapply [FastISel] Let the target decide first if it... |
blob | commitdiff | raw |
2014-08-14 |
Juergen Ributzka | Revert several FastISel commits to track down a buildbo... |
blob | commitdiff | raw | diff to current |
2014-08-13 |
Juergen Ributzka | [FastISel] Let the target decide first if it wants... |
blob | commitdiff | raw |
2014-07-30 |
Juergen Ributzka | [FastISel] Move the helper function isCommutativeIntrin... |
blob | commitdiff | raw | diff to current |
2014-07-11 |
Juergen Ributzka | [FastISel] Add target-independent patchpoint intrinsic... |
blob | commitdiff | raw | diff to current |
2014-07-11 |
Juergen Ributzka | [FastISel] Add basic infrastructure to support a target... |
blob | commitdiff | raw | diff to current |
2014-07-11 |
Juergen Ributzka | [FastISel] Breakout intrinsic lowering into a separate... |
blob | commitdiff | raw | diff to current |
2014-07-04 |
Eric Christopher | Move function dependent resetting of a subtarget variab... |
blob | commitdiff | raw | diff to current |
2014-07-01 |
Juergen Ributzka | [FastISel] Factor out stackmap intrinsic selection... |
blob | commitdiff | raw | diff to current |
2014-06-12 |
Juergen Ributzka | [FastISel][X86] Add MachineMemOperand to load/store... |
blob | commitdiff | raw | diff to current |
2014-06-12 |
Juergen Ributzka | [FastISel] Add support for the stackmap intrinsic. |
blob | commitdiff | raw | diff to current |
2014-06-10 |
Juergen Ributzka | [FastISel][X86] Extend support for {s|u}{add|sub|mul... |
blob | commitdiff | raw | diff to current |
2014-04-15 |
Tim Northover | FastISel: constrain the RegClass of operands when emitt... |
blob | commitdiff | raw | diff to current |
2014-03-12 |
Patrik Hagglund | Replace '#include ValueTypes.h' with forward declarations. |
blob | commitdiff | raw | diff to current |
2014-02-18 |
Rafael Espindola | Rename a DebugLoc variable to DbgLoc and a DataLayout... |
blob | commitdiff | raw | diff to current |
2013-11-15 |
Bob Wilson | Avoid illegal integer promotion in fastisel |
blob | commitdiff | raw | diff to current |
2013-07-10 |
Michael Gottesman | Changed "mode: c++" => "C++" at the suggestion of Nick... |
blob | commitdiff | raw | diff to current |
2013-07-09 |
Michael Gottesman | Fixed up the comments in FastISel.h so that they confor... |
blob | commitdiff | raw | diff to current |
2013-07-09 |
Michael Gottesman | Added "mode: c++" to FastISel.h header. |
blob | commitdiff | raw | diff to current |
2013-06-13 |
Jakub Staszak | Remove forward declaration of MachineBasicBlock. It... |
blob | commitdiff | raw | diff to current |
2013-04-19 |
Eli Bendersky | Simplify the code in FastISel::tryToFoldLoad, add an... |
blob | commitdiff | raw | diff to current |
2013-04-19 |
Eli Bendersky | Move TryToFoldFastISelLoad to FastISel, where it belong... |
blob | commitdiff | raw | diff to current |
2013-02-27 |
Michael Ilseman | Reverted: r176136 - Have a way for a target to opt... |
blob | commitdiff | raw | diff to current |
2013-02-26 |
Michael Ilseman | Have a way for a target to opt-out of target-independen... |
blob | commitdiff | raw | diff to current |
2013-02-11 |
Evan Cheng | Currently, codegen may spent some time in SDISel passes... |
blob | commitdiff | raw | diff to current |
2012-12-11 |
Chad Rosier | Fall back to the selection dag isel to select tail... |
blob | commitdiff | raw | diff to current |
2012-12-03 |
Chandler Carruth | Sort the #include lines for the include/... tree with... |
blob | commitdiff | raw | diff to current |
2012-10-08 |
Micah Villmow | Move TargetData to DataLayout. |
blob | commitdiff | raw | diff to current |
2012-10-03 |
Eric Christopher | Revert 165051-165049 while looking into the foreach... |
blob | commitdiff | raw | diff to current |
2012-10-02 |
Eric Christopher | Remove the SavePoint infrastructure from fast isel... |
blob | commitdiff | raw | diff to current |
2012-08-03 |
Bob Wilson | Fall back to selection DAG isel for calls to builtin... |
blob | commitdiff | raw | diff to current |
2012-06-01 |
Manman Ren | ARM: properly handle alignment for struct byval. |
blob | commitdiff | raw | diff to current |
2011-12-09 |
Chad Rosier | [fast-isel] Add support for selecting insertvalue. |
blob | commitdiff | raw | diff to current |
2011-11-29 |
Chad Rosier | If fast-isel fails, remove dead instructions generated... |
blob | commitdiff | raw | diff to current |
2011-11-14 |
Benjamin Kramer | Make headers standalone. |
blob | commitdiff | raw | diff to current |
2011-08-18 |
Ivan Krasin | FastISel: avoid function calls between the materializat... |
blob | commitdiff | raw | diff to current |
2011-07-19 |
Devang Patel | Revert r135423. |
blob | commitdiff | raw | diff to current |
2011-07-18 |
Devang Patel | During bottom up fast-isel, instructions emitted to... |
blob | commitdiff | raw | diff to current |
2011-06-29 |
Devang Patel | Revert r133953 for now. |
blob | commitdiff | raw | diff to current |
2011-06-27 |
Devang Patel | During bottom up fast-isel, instructions emitted to... |
blob | commitdiff | raw | diff to current |
2011-05-16 |
Eli Friedman | Make fast-isel work correctly s/uadd.with.overflow... |
blob | commitdiff | raw | diff to current |
2011-05-16 |
Eli Friedman | Basic fast-isel of extractvalue. Not too helpful on... |
blob | commitdiff | raw | diff to current |
2011-05-05 |
Owen Anderson | Allow FastISel of three-register-operand instructions. |
blob | commitdiff | raw | diff to current |
2011-04-27 |
Eli Friedman | Make the fast-isel code for literal 0.0 a bit shorter... |
blob | commitdiff | raw | diff to current |
2011-04-27 |
Eli Friedman | Remove unused function. |
blob | commitdiff | raw | diff to current |
2011-04-22 |
Owen Anderson | Teach FastISel to deal with instructions that have... |
blob | commitdiff | raw | diff to current |
2011-04-22 |
Eric Christopher | Fix comment. |
blob | commitdiff | raw | diff to current |
2011-03-11 |
Owen Anderson | Teach FastISel to support register-immediate-immediate... |
blob | commitdiff | raw | diff to current |
2010-11-06 |
Benjamin Kramer | Prune includes. |
blob | commitdiff | raw | diff to current |
2010-09-05 |
Chris Lattner | implement rdar://6653118 - fastisel should fold loads... |
blob | commitdiff | raw | diff to current |
2010-07-14 |
Dan Gohman | Delete fast-isel's trivial load optimization; it breaks... |
blob | commitdiff | raw | diff to current |
2010-07-14 |
Dan Gohman | Don't propagate debug locations to instructions for... |
blob | commitdiff | raw | diff to current |
2010-07-10 |
Dan Gohman | Reapply bottom-up fast-isel, with several fixes for... |
blob | commitdiff | raw | diff to current |
2010-07-09 |
Bob Wilson | --- Reverse-merging r107947 into '.': |
blob | commitdiff | raw | diff to current |
2010-07-09 |
Dan Gohman | Re-apply bottom-up fast-isel, with fixes. Be very caref... |
blob | commitdiff | raw | diff to current |
2010-07-08 |
Dan Gohman | Revert 107840 107839 107813 107804 107800 107797 107791. |
blob | commitdiff | raw | diff to current |
2010-07-07 |
Dan Gohman | Implement bottom-up fast-isel. This has the advantage... |
blob | commitdiff | raw | diff to current |
2010-07-07 |
Dan Gohman | Give FunctionLoweringInfo an MBB member, avoiding the... |
blob | commitdiff | raw | diff to current |
2010-07-07 |
Dan Gohman | Simplify FastISel's constructor by giving it a Function... |
blob | commitdiff | raw | diff to current |
2010-07-01 |
Dan Gohman | Teach fast-isel to avoid loading a value from memory... |
blob | commitdiff | raw | diff to current |
2010-06-18 |
Dan Gohman | Teach regular and fast isel to set dead flags on unused... |
blob | commitdiff | raw | diff to current |
2010-06-17 |
Stuart Hastings | Add a DebugLoc parameter to TargetInstrInfo::InsertBran... |
blob | commitdiff | raw | diff to current |
2010-05-11 |
Dan Gohman | Add initial kill flag support to FastISel. |
blob | commitdiff | raw | diff to current |
2010-05-05 |
Dan Gohman | Add an "IsBottomUp" member function to FastISel, which... |
blob | commitdiff | raw | diff to current |
2010-05-03 |
Dan Gohman | Factor out FastISel's code for materializing constants... |
blob | commitdiff | raw | diff to current |
2010-04-23 |
Dan Gohman | Move FastISel's HandlePHINodesInSuccessorBlocks call... |
blob | commitdiff | raw | diff to current |
2010-04-22 |
Dan Gohman | Move HandlePHINodesInSuccessorBlocks functions out... |
blob | commitdiff | raw | diff to current |
2010-04-20 |
Dan Gohman | Sink DebugLoc handling out of SelectionDAGISel into... |
blob | commitdiff | raw | diff to current |
2010-04-15 |
Dan Gohman | Add const qualifiers to CodeGen's use of LLVM IR constr... |
blob | commitdiff | raw | diff to current |
2010-04-14 |
Dan Gohman | Factor out EH landing pad code into a separate function... |
blob | commitdiff | raw | diff to current |
2010-04-14 |
Dan Gohman | Fix a missing #include. |
blob | commitdiff | raw | diff to current |
2010-04-14 |
Dan Gohman | Refine #includes. |
blob | commitdiff | raw | diff to current |
2010-04-05 |
Chris Lattner | trim some prototypes. |
blob | commitdiff | raw | diff to current |
2010-04-05 |
Chris Lattner | unthread MMI from FastISel |
blob | commitdiff | raw | diff to current |
2010-04-05 |
Chris Lattner | fastisel doesn't need DwarfWriter, remove some tendricles. |
blob | commitdiff | raw | diff to current |
2010-01-05 |
Dan Gohman | Don't use the ISD::NodeType enum for SDNode opcodes... |
blob | commitdiff | raw | diff to current |
2009-12-05 |
Dan Gohman | Make TargetSelectInstruction protected and called from... |
blob | commitdiff | raw | diff to current |
2009-10-05 |
Dan Gohman | Fix a name in a comment. |
blob | commitdiff | raw | diff to current |
2009-09-03 |
Dan Gohman | LLVM currently represents floating-point negation as... |
blob | commitdiff | raw | diff to current |
2009-08-11 |
Owen Anderson | Split EVT into MVT and EVT, the former representing... |
blob | commitdiff | raw | diff to current |
2009-08-10 |
Owen Anderson | Rename MVT to EVT, in preparation for splitting SimpleV... |
blob | commitdiff | raw | diff to current |
2009-07-22 |
Owen Anderson | Get rid of the Pass+Context magic. |
blob | commitdiff | raw | diff to current |
2009-07-13 |
Owen Anderson | Begin the painful process of tearing apart the rat... |
blob | commitdiff | raw | diff to current |
2009-06-19 |
Devang Patel | mv CodeGen/DebugLoc.h Support/DebugLoc.h |
blob | commitdiff | raw | diff to current |
2009-05-21 |
Bill Wendling | Temporarily revert r72191. It was causing an assert... |
blob | commitdiff | raw | diff to current |
2009-05-20 |
Argyrios Kyrtzidis | Introduce DebugScope which gets embedded into the machi... |
blob | commitdiff | raw | diff to current |
2009-04-16 |
Devang Patel | If FastISel is run and it has known DebugLoc then use it. |
blob | commitdiff | raw | diff to current |
2009-04-12 |
Chris Lattner | optimize FastISel::UpdateValueMap to avoid duplicate... |
blob | commitdiff | raw | diff to current |
2009-03-13 |
Dan Gohman | Fix FastISel's assumption that i1 values are always... |
blob | commitdiff | raw | diff to current |
2009-02-03 |
Bill Wendling | Create DebugLoc information in FastISel. Several tempor... |
blob | commitdiff | raw | diff to current |
2009-01-22 |
Evan Cheng | Eliminate a couple of fields from TargetRegisterClass... |
blob | commitdiff | raw | diff to current |
2009-01-13 |
Devang Patel | Use DebugInfo interface to lower dbg_* intrinsics. |
blob | commitdiff | raw | diff to current |
2009-01-05 |
Dan Gohman | Tidy up #includes, deleting a bunch of unnecessary... |
blob | commitdiff | raw | diff to current |
2008-12-08 |
Dan Gohman | Factor out the code for sign-extending/truncating gep... |
blob | commitdiff | raw | diff to current |
2008-10-14 |
Dan Gohman | FastISel support for exception-handling constructs. |
blob | commitdiff | raw | diff to current |
2008-10-04 |
Dan Gohman | Fix fast-isel's handling of atomic instructions. They may |
blob | commitdiff | raw | diff to current |
2008-10-02 |
Dan Gohman | Optimize conditional branches in X86FastISel. This... |
blob | commitdiff | raw | diff to current |
2008-09-29 |
Dan Gohman | Fix FastISel to not initialize the PIC-base register... |
blob | commitdiff | raw | diff to current |
2008-09-25 |
Dan Gohman | FastISel support for debug info. |
blob | commitdiff | raw | diff to current |
2008-09-23 |
Dan Gohman | Arrange for FastISel code to have access to the Machine... |
blob | commitdiff | raw | diff to current |
next |